On Friday, May 16th and Saturday, May 17th at 8 PM, MCCLV will
present an evening of entertainment at their new space at 930
North 4th Street to introduce the community to their plans for a
new theater company.

The company is currently planning on doing two major productions a
year, as well as evenings of one-acts, performance art, scenes &
monologues, and musical revues.

May 16 & 17 will include scenes from:

-Fall 2008 musical comedy production of "The Big Voice: God or
Merman" - Book by Jim Brochu, Music & Lyrics by Steve Schalchlin.
A chamber musical about growing up gay and religious, long-term
gay relationships, AIDS, and the spiritual and healing powers of
show biz;

-Winter 2009 production of "Their Town" by Paula Martinac. A
gay-themed comedy on gay marriage rights inspired by the classic
"Our Town";

-Fall 2009 production of the musical "Godspell" by Stephen
Schwartz & John-Michael Tebelak. Set in a trendy gay neighborhood
with a GLBTA cast.

-It will also include monologues, musical numbers, and staged
readings - setting a precedent for future evenings of performance
art/readings/monologues of original material by artists based on
their personal life experiences.
